Postdoctoral researcher in Physics at the Max-Planck Institute for Physics in Munich (Germany). He studied at the University of Trieste, where he obtained his PhD in Physics in 2018, before moving to the University of Turin and then, in 2021, to the Max-Planck Institute for Physics. His research is in the field of very-high-energy astrophysics and is carried out within the MAGIC and LST-1 international collaborations, which operate two arrays of Cherenkov telescopes in La Palma, Canary Islands (Spain). His main field of research is so-called transient sources, in particular gamma-ray bursts.
